Session 6: Dressed to the Nines

Winter 28, 6840 CA  

Dress to Impress

  Having been paid thirty gold pieces by Havmos, the group decide to get a jump on preparations and head into the city to pick up some new fancy clothes. They make their way to First Cut, a fancy uptown shop for clientele that are a cut above these wandering adventurers. The proprietor Gimble is able to find them all suitable clothes tailored to fit, although Yuri opts to save some of the money and just take something off the rack.   Uniforms are collected for Ursa's catering service, as well as a good location for a smart haircut and bath. They have some trouble finding a place that will take someone like Wally until they find an outdoors grooming shop meant for pets and livestock. A few buckets of water and shampoo and a stiff bristle brush does the job of leaving Wally smelling refreshingly like not from the sewer. While they're at it, the two mutts are brought in to get cleaned at a nice group rate! The whole experience of this tiny naked gnome man being bathed is horrifying and Zed tips the service as way of an apology.  

Embrace the Theater!

  Valia and Zed are insistent that they show off Yuriel in his fancy new outfit to Mama Ava. Yuriel is justifiably horrified at this prospect, but seems to have accepted that he no longer has any control over his life and relents. The group head over to the Wanderlust and horrified to see Ava isn't running the bar. Instead, they find her over with Onzo and his troupe rehearsing lines. They arrive in time to hear Ava giving an unforgettable performance as Yuumira the Tiefling, a character from Mordo's Mysterious Mythologies.   Onzo ropes Ursa and Wally into playing a few roles and he is delighted by how much emotion Ursa brings to the part and the creepiness Wally naturally exudes for the character of Rax. They're the perfect fit! Valia is roped in as well, but Zed and Yuriel are reluctant to get involved even despite Ava's insistence they give it a try. Mark Yuriel as maybe on a small bit role. Zed will need a little more convincing.   Ursa asks Ava about getting some food and help for the dinner, to which Ava is only to pleased to help. She's even more pleased to learn that Yuri has become an apprentice chef apparently! She's eager to help out when she finds out that Ursa is catering to a party with the mayor in attendance and offers her services and picking up any ingredients that Ursa will need. In the meantime, Ursa will be heading back to the Mince the Mark Bakery to work with her dad on baking up a variety of treats.   Winter 31, 6840 CA  

The Gala

  Havmos and Valia enter from the main entrance. Valia chose a nice slimming black dress for the event, though Havmos chose to not fancy himself as much as he could have. Most of the attendees had already arrived and they entered into a crowded ball room with multitudes of conversations and many already out dancing while serenaded by a band of musicians. Havmos points out some of the more prominent people in the party and as they make the rounds, he introduces Valia to Sionia Caeldark, daughter of Aelwynn Caeldark.   During the conversation, Valia spies Commander Dasan Briggs in the crowd. Following behind him is a tall redheaded man that she immediately recognizes as one of her siblings. The two men head into a private room away from the rest of the attendees. She drags Havmos over to speak with the Mayor and Ilyana as an opportunity to get closer to her brother. She doesn't hear any conversation on the other side, so she attempts to communicate telepathically with Dasan, but it's made clear she's not invited. Shucks.  

Kitchen Spies

  Ursa arrives with the rest of the group, Ava and her kitchen staff, and Horatio to the servant's entrance at the estate. Ursa is quick to organize everyone to start making meals! Spinach puffs, fern fiddleheads, mushroom soup, trout pie, ribs and potatoes, blueberry lemon tarts, and all manner of drinks courtesy of the Wanderlust. The group is suitably impressed with the spread and get to work. Yuri proves himself quite the adept vegetable cutter. Upon noticing how into the food prep is, Horatio reminds the group that they're supposed to be doing stealth work.   Ursa and Wally are reluctant to leave the kitchen, but Horatio's stealth magic and the lack of heavy armor gives them them the confidence that they'll be able to get in without too much fuss. They slip past the gardener and up to the servant's rooms. Wally uses this time to ritually cast Detect Magic. A pair of guards are on the balcony watching the party, so the group are able to slip around them without notice. After checking some of the other rooms, Wally determines there's some Abjuration magic coming off the door knobs. A trap, perhaps?   No one has any other ideas, so Wally transforms himself into a millipede and crawls underneath the door. The room seems safe, so he reverts to his normal form and carefully unlocks the door. Nothing seems amiss and the magic disipates. Horatio suspects it was an Arcane Lock. Inside the room are some smutty romance novels, a private window room, the normal trappings of any bedroom, and three armored statues that will in no way be relevant later. No secrets here, though. Wally detects more magic ahead and it seems to be another Arcane Lock. Zed hasn't replaced her lockpicks yet, so Horatio picks the lock for them.   Wally detects yet even more magic, now in a cube in the hallway ahead. They don't know how to avoid tripping whatever it is, so Ursa uses her echo to teleport out of range of it. This takes her into a large walk in closet filled with dresses, shoes, and other private items. A mirror catches her interest and she goes to investigate it, unknowingly setting off an Alarm spell that was outside of Wally's range. Immediately, the three armored statues spring to life and notice the intruders in the room. They move in to attack. A bloody battle ensues which sees the party struggle to survive as Wally, Yuri, and Zed both drop at multiple points during the combat. They manage to succeed when Ursa heroically charges out of the bathroom and kills the last of the three armored constructs.   Blood and bedraggled, the group make their way back into the closet and Ursa determines an illusion spell is concealing a secret room. They find a hidden study inside and go to work. Yuri and Horatio find some notes that are in some kind of code. Horatio starts to decode it and makes out a date from ten years ago: Summer 24, 6829. Yuri and Wally start looking through the journal for that date, but that entire week seems to be skipped over. Wally however sees writing transposed over what Yuri is able to see. Wally is able to read some of it and determines it has something to do with an Eye and that Bilmin Pebbledust, the dwarves, and the Brass Whispers were all involved.   They take the ciphered notes with them but leave the journal behind. Horatio places his Pass without a Trace spell up again and the group try to make their way back. One by one they make it into the servant's quarters unnoticed... until the guards turn and notice Ursa and Wally. Jinkies!
